Transaction 648bf2ebfad376eed45acd4c28ff14bf3da43af3901fdd020940abb039efefa7
1 Input
1 Output
-
648bf2ebfad376eed45acd4c28ff14bf3da43af3901fdd020940abb039efefa7:0
- value
- 2128544
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8490323306528d0e4ba92630263b0c3104144c1
- address
- bc1qmpysxgesv55dpe96jf3sycascvgyz3xpgcq59q